Meadia Heights Golf Club is located two miles south from the city center of historic Lancaster, Pennsylvania, and is managed by Bobby Jones Links. The club offers a challenging private 18-hole championship course layout, draped over rolling hills bordering the area’s world-famous farmland.

Meadia Heights is hiring for a Head Golf Professional. Primary responsibilities include:

  • Prepare annual and monthly budgets for golf operations while taking corrective actions to meet financial goals.
  • Reconcile daily, weekly, and monthly activities.
  • Oversee all golf tournaments, including sales, operations, and billing collection.
  • Order merchandise for the golf shop to ensure the best selection possible within inventory constraints and guarantee that the shop achieves at least a 30% profit annually.
  • Provide golf lessons to members and guests while supervising the club's instruction program, offering expert advice on golf techniques, equipment selection, and course management.
  • Collaborate with marketing to advertise services and activities to potential customers and members to develop and conduct junior golf clinics.
  • Coordinate with the golf course superintendent regarding playability and course conditioning issues.
  • Order supplies related to golf activities.
  • Maintain an attractive, clean, and organized appearance in the golf pro shop, cart staging area, and driving range.
  • Hire, train, supervise, and evaluate all golf department personnel.
  • Plan professional development and training activities for the staff.
  • Collect charges and fees for all golf-related activities.
  • Organize and conduct club tournaments and related events. Interpret and enforce club policies, rules, and regulations.
  • Maintain records related to player and guest rounds and other statistics.
  • Plan social golf events to promote golf and fellowship among members and guests.
  • Follow all federal, state, and local health, safety, and employment laws. Assist in developing short- and long-term plans to enhance club facilities and courses.
  • Collaborate with the food and beverage director on event food and beverage requirements.
  • Maintain a visible presence on the course or in the golf shop during peak play times.
  • Ensure starting times comply with the club’s rules and regulations.
  • Provide for the collection and distribution of all prizes associated with competitions.
  • Implement a comprehensive safety program for the golf department that aligns with OSHA standards. Manage the orientation program for new golf members.
  • Stay informed about current and projected industry developments.
  • Attend club management staff meetings.
  • Perform other relevant tasks assigned by the General Manager.
